Mazonia, N & S 5/ 4 thru 5/19

Postby localyokal » Wed May 23, 2012 7:31 pm

May has been a very busy month for me. Not getting out as much as I had hoped to , but still getting out every weekend. Just been too busy to post. Been a good month, getting at least one nice hog and several good fish every time out. A little bit of everything has been working with the Kreature bait fished on a plain 1/16 oz owner jig hook getting the edge on both big fish and numbers, but a weightless Senko, soft bodied swim bait and the spinner bait have all taken some nice fish. Frog bite has been slow for me but buzz bait has been producing some nice medium sized fish (13” – 16”) Almost everytime out they seemed to be hitting on something different. Bass have pretty much finished their thing and gills are bedding everywhere right now. Off to Kickapoo this weekend.

Some pics of this month’s better fish.

Clear Lake 5/4. Lots of dinks and one good fish. Morning bite was slow but picked up after 10:00 am

Tube fished in the N Unit 5/11. Fished two ponds. Around 35, 11" to 15", bass mostly swimming a creature bait.

Fished in the S unit, Wilderness Area on 5/12. Only Ok for numbers but real decent for average size. Most fish were in the 14" to 16" range. I had a huge bass take a swipe at an eleven inch bass I had hooked and Kevin boated this 5 lb + bass and a huge crappie on a soft plastic swim bait.

Tube fished a couple of lakes in the S Unit on 5/19. Real decent day for decent sized fish. I lipped 36 bass with 6 over 16", a 17" 18 1/2", 19" and a 22" hog. Jim also got several 16' bass, a 17" and a nice 20 incher. Caught fish on everything today. Kreature bait, weigtless Senko, Spinner Bait, Frog, Buzz Bait, Swim Senko.
